WebApr 6, 2024 · The Haldane Effect describes the effect of oxygen on CO2 transport. The Haldane Effect (along with the Bohr Effect) facilitates the release of O2 at the tissues and the uptake of O2 at the lungs. Then, with oxygenation at the lungs CO2 dissociates more readily from hemoglobin. WebThe Haldane effect describes the ability of deoxygenated haemoglobin to carry more CO 2 than oxygenated haemoglobin. This occurs for two reasons: Deoxygenated haemoglobin …
